Second-wettest May in 57 years

June 10, 2025 PVNPublisher 0
May produces 21 days with rain; year-to-date rainfall now above average By Carl Quintrell, weather correspondent STANLEY — Total rainfall for May was 8.47 inches, or 4.34 inches above the May average of 4.13 inches. […]

April showers deliver less than half of average rain

May 5, 2025 PVNPublisher 0
Year-to-date rainfall already 2.5 inches below average through four months By Carl Quintrell, weather correspondent STANLEY — Total rain for the month was 1.30 inches, or 1.71 inches below the April average of 3.01 inches. […]
